Brunswick and Camden Hills are an even 5-5 against one another since May of 2017, but likely not for long. The Brunswick Dragons will be playing in front of their home fans against the Camden Hills Windjammers at 4:00 p.m. on Wednesday. Neither Brunswick nor Camden Hills posted many runs in their last games, so it might be the pitching crews that decide this one.
On Monday, Brunswick came up short against Messalonskee and fell 5-2. Brunswick has struggled against Messalonskee recently, as their contest on Monday was their fourth consecutive lost matchup.
Meanwhile, Camden Hills was not able to break out of their rough patch on Monday as the team picked up their fourth straight loss. They lost 7-1 to Mt. Blue.
Camden Hills sa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Cameron Brown, who went 1-for-3 with a stolen base.
Brunswick's defeat 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 4-5. As for Camden Hills, their loss dropped their record down to 4-7.
Brunswick took their win against Camden Hills in their previous matchup back in April by a conclusive 7-0. Will Brunswick repeat their success, or does Camden Hills have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
